Personal Development as seen by Neuroscience, by Swann Xerri, KEDGE graduate

Swann Xerri (class of 2004), coach and lecturer, has just published his first book, co-written with his father, Director of Research Emeritus at the CNRS. The book looks at self-development and progress based on the science of change.

Personal development is a key element in our personal and professional lives, because it's about self-discovery and unleashing our full potential. That said, personal development is often perceived as too conceptual and therefore lacking in credibility or effectiveness. To write this book, Swann Xerri called on her father, who is an Emeritus Researcher in Neuroscience at the CNRS (French National Centre for Scientific Research), to combine their disciplines and expertise in order to provide personal development with scientific justifications that bring intellectual rigor and keys to practical applications.

Swann, can you tell us more about your background and your time at KEDGE?

"I've been researching performance and leadership for 20 years. My initial work began during my Sports Science studies in Marseille, on improving sports performance. I continued my work during a Master's year at KEDGE, transposing these performance keys into the corporate environment.

 

As someone who doesn't come from a family of entrepreneurs, my time at KEDGE, its teaching staff and the people I met nurtured my ambition and self-confidence, and gave me the key skills I needed to find my professional path. Many former kedgers have become close friends and some professional partners.

 

Finally, through my own career path, I have been able to bridge the gap between theory and practice to perfect my expertise and experience. I've spent most of my professional life as an entrepreneur, setting upa dozen companies in a variety of sectors (sports, finance, real estate, business development, training and consulting). Today, I run my own leadership and performance consultancy, "The Best Me", with which I support clients ranging from small businesses in the French provinces to some CAC40 companies. With 2 associates, I also created "Le Cercle des Leaders ", aclub of passionate and committed entrepreneurs. "
